Bible Verse

“So Christ himself gave the apostles, the prophets, the evangelists, the pastors and teachers, to equip his people for works of service, so that the body of Christ may be built up.” – Ephesians 4:11-12 (NIV)

Meaning

In these verses, we see that Christ has given specific roles within the church for the purpose of equipping and building up believers. The apostles, prophets, evangelists, pastors, and teachers are all instrumental in carrying out this mission. Each member of the body of Christ has a valuable role to play in serving and edifying one another.

Q&A about Ephesians 4:11-12

Q: What are the specific roles that God has appointed for some people in the church, according to Ephesians 4:11?
A: According to Ephesians 4:11, God has appointed some to be apostles, some to be prophets, some to be evangelists, and some to be pastors and teachers.

Q: What is the purpose of these roles within the church, as stated in Ephesians 4:12?
A: According to Ephesians 4:12, these roles are meant to equip the saints for the work of ministry, for building up the body of Christ.

Q: How does Ephesians 4:12 emphasize the importance of the different roles within the church?
A: Ephesians 4:12 emphasizes that these roles are essential for the maturing of the church and the unity of the faith.

Q: What does it mean to “equip the saints for the work of ministry” as mentioned in Ephesians 4:12?
A: “Equipping the saints for the work of ministry” refers to preparing and empowering believers to serve and carry out the work of spreading the gospel and building up the body of Christ.
